Do you desire to cultivate your own bountiful harvest of fresh produce? Starting an organic garden can be a fulfilling endeavor, even if you're just starting out. Here are some simple tips to help you cultivate your very own green oasis:
* **Choose the right place.** Your garden should receive at least six hours of sunlight per day and have well-drained soil.
* **Amend your soil.** Add compost or other organic matter to enrich your soil and provide nutrients for your plants.
* **Select the perfect plants for your climate.** Research get more info which vegetables, fruits, or herbs will do well in your area.
* **Moisturize consistently.** Most plants need about an inch of water per week.
* **Suppress weeds and pests organically.** Use techniques like hand weeding, companion planting, or beneficial insects to keep your garden healthy.

Unlocking the Secrets of Organic Food Production
Organic food production is a fascinating journey into sustainable agriculture. By championing natural methods, farmers cultivate nutrient-rich produce that nourishes both the body and the environment.
A key principle of organic farming is the rejection of synthetic pesticides, herbicides, and fertilizers. Instead, farmers rely natural solutions to mitigate pests and diseases, enhancing a healthy ecosystem.
Moreover, organic farming emphasizes soil health by implementing practices such as crop alternation and composting. This enriches the soil's fertility, creating a more abundant harvest.
The benefits of organic food production are numerous. Consumers obtain the rewards of flavorful produce that is free from harmful contaminants. Moreover, organic farming contributes to environmental conservation, protecting our natural resources for future generations.
